Marc Marquez is the fastest rider in the first 125 test session in Barcelona. The Spanish driver, third in the championship standings, stopped the clock at 1'51.219 with his Derbi, taking the advantage over his rivals.

In fact, with the second time is Bradley Smith, in difficulty this season, who preceded his teammate and leader Nico Terol, more than 7 tenths behind Marc Marquez.

Pol Espargaro, much awaited in Barcelona, ​​was only fourth due to a crash, ahead of his teammate Efren Vazquez and the Germans Jonas Folger and Sandro Cortese.

The first Italian is Simone Grotzkyj with the 16th time, in the last three positions the Italians Luca Marconi, Lorenzo Savadori and Marco Ravaioli. Wild card Peter Sebestyen is out of 107% due to a fall.
